"用户角色权限表设计:灵活、通用、方便,实现资源权限管理系统目标"
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
用户表角色权限表的设计.doc 用户表角色权限表的设计.doc 用户·角色·权限·表的设计 引言 在系统设计过程中,权限管理功能是一个不可或缺的部分。尽管不断完善,但仍然存在一些不尽如人意的地方。因此,有必要抽出时间来重新思考权限系统的设计。每个应用系统都需要对系统的权限进行设计,以满足不同系统用户的需求,因此设计一个相对通用的权限系统是非常有意义的。在这种情况下,用户表角色权限表的设计成为非常重要的一环。 设计目标 设计一个灵活、通用、方便的权限管理系统是我们的目标。在这个系统中,我们需要对系统的所有资源进行权限控制。这些资源可以简单分为静态资源(功能操作、数据列)和动态资源(数据),也称为对象资源和数据资源。系统的目标是对应用系统的所有对象资源和数据资源进行权限控制,包括功能菜单等。 系统设计 用户表 用户表是权限系统的核心部分。用户表中包括用户的基本信息,如用户名、密码、真实姓名等。在用户表中,每个用户都被赋予一个唯一的用户ID,用于标识用户在系统中的身份。此外,用户表还包括用户的角色ID和权限ID等信息,用于关联用户和角色、权限。 角色表 角色表是权限系统中的另一个重要部分。在角色表中,定义了系统中的各种角色,如管理员、普通用户等。每个角色都被赋予一个唯一的角色ID,用于标识不同的角色。在角色表中,还包括角色的权限ID,用于定义不同角色所拥有的权限。 权限表 权限表是权限系统中非常重要的一部分。在权限表中,定义了系统中的各种权限,如查看、修改、删除等。每种权限都被赋予一个唯一的权限ID,用于标识不同的权限。在权限表中,还包括权限所属的角色ID,用于关联不同角色所拥有的权限。 用户-角色-权限关联表 用户-角色-权限关联表是权限系统中用户、角色和权限之间的关联表。在这个表中,定义了用户与角色之间的关联关系,以及角色与权限之间的关联关系。通过这个表,可以灵活地管理用户的角色和权限,以满足不同用户的需求。 系统资源表 系统资源表是权限系统中一个重要的部分,其中包括系统的所有对象资源和数据资源。在这个表中,定义了系统中的所有资源,如功能菜单、数据列等。每种资源都被赋予一个唯一的资源ID,用于标识不同的资源。在系统资源表中,还包括资源的权限ID,用于定义不同资源所需要的权限。 设计原则 在设计用户表角色权限表的过程中,遵循了一些设计原则。首先,明确了系统的设计目标,即设计一个灵活、通用、方便的权限管理系统。其次,采用了标准化的设计,将用户、角色、权限等模块进行了分离,以便于后期的维护和扩展。此外,还遵循了简单、高效的原则,尽量减少了系统的复杂性,提高了系统的性能和可维护性。 总结 用户表角色权限表的设计是一个非常重要的部分,它直接影响着整个系统的权限管理功能。通过对用户、角色、权限等模块的设计,我们设计了一个灵活、通用、方便的权限管理系统。在这个系统中,用户可以灵活地管理角色和权限,满足不同用户的需求。通过系统资源表,我们可以定义系统中的所有资源,并将资源与权限进行关联,实现对系统资源的权限控制。在设计的过程中,我们遵循了一些设计原则,使得系统具有简单、高效、标准化等特点。因此,用户表角色权限表的设计将为整个系统的权限管理功能提供良好的支持。
剩余20页未读,继续阅读
- 粉丝: 15
- 资源: 19万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 计算机人脸表情动画技术发展综述
- 关系数据库的关键字搜索技术综述:模型、架构与未来趋势
- 迭代自适应逆滤波在语音情感识别中的应用
- 概念知识树在旅游领域智能分析中的应用
- 构建is-a层次与OWL本体集成:理论与算法
- 基于语义元的相似度计算方法研究:改进与有效性验证
- 网格梯度多密度聚类算法:去噪与高效聚类
- 网格服务工作流动态调度算法PGSWA研究
- 突发事件连锁反应网络模型与应急预警分析
- BA网络上的病毒营销与网站推广仿真研究
- 离散HSMM故障预测模型:有效提升系统状态预测
- 煤矿安全评价:信息融合与可拓理论的应用
- 多维度Petri网工作流模型MD_WFN:统一建模与应用研究
- 面向过程追踪的知识安全描述方法
- 基于收益的软件过程资源调度优化策略
- 多核环境下基于数据流Java的Web服务器优化实现提升性能